Paramount+ has dropped the official trailer and key art for Season 10 of “RuPaul’s Drag Race All Stars,” set to premiere with two brand-new episodes on Friday, May 9 at 12AM ET/9PM PT. The milestone season features the largest cast in All Stars history — a stunning lineup of 18 returning queens ready to compete for the crown, a $200,000 grand prize, and a place in the iconic Drag Race Hall of Fame.
In a first for the franchise, the tenth season introduces the Tournament of All Stars, a game-changing format that divides the queens into three groups of six. Each group competes in its own bracket over three episodes, with the top point earners advancing to the semi-finals. After another fierce round of eliminations, the top finalists face off in a Lip Sync Smackdown for the Crown in a finale that promises to go down in Drag Race herstory.
This season’s cast includes fan favorites and fierce competitors such as Acid Betty, Aja, Alyssa Hunter, Bosco, Cynthia Lee Fontaine, Daya Betty, DeJa Skye, Denali, Ginger Minj, Irene the Alien, Jorgeous, Kerri Colby, Lydia B Kollins, Mistress Isabelle Brooks, Nicole Paige Brooks, Olivia Lux, Phoenix, and Tina Burner.
Alongside the competition, “RuPaul’s Drag Race All Stars: Untucked“returns, giving fans exclusive backstage access to all the drama, shade, and heart-to-hearts as the queens wait for their fate. Episodes of Untucked will also begin streaming May 9 on Paramount+.
The new season will feature a star-studded panel of guest judges, including Ice Spice (who appears in the premiere), Chappell Roan, Ariana Grande & Cynthia Erivo, Colman Domingo, Kate Beckinsale, Susanne Bartsch, Adam Shankman, Jamal Sims, Mayan Lopez, Devery Jacobs and Sarah Michelle Gellar, joining RuPaul and the returning judge panel of Michelle Visage, Carson Kressley, Ross Mathews, Ts Madison, and Law Roach.
